There are 10 unique combinations possible when selecting 2 out of 5 letters.

To find the number of unique letter combinations possible using 2 out of 5 letters, we can use the concept of combinations.

In this case, we have 5 letters to choose from, and we need to select 2 of them. The order in which we select the letters does not matter (since the question asks for combinations, not permutations).

The formula to calculate the number of combinations is:

C(n, r) = n! / (r!(n - r)!)

where n is the total number of items, and r is the number of items to be selected. The exclamation mark (!) represents the factorial operation.

Applying the formula to our scenario, we have:

C(5, 2) = 5! / (2!(5 - 2)!)

= 5! / (2! * 3!)

= (5 * 4 * 3!) / (2! * 3!)

= (5 * 4) / 2!

= (5 * 4) / (2 * 1)

= 10

Therefore, there are 10 unique combinations possible when selecting 2 out of 5 letters.

If a person climbing the stairs can take one stair or two stairs at a time, we can determine the number of ways to climb a given number of stairs using dynamic programming.

Let's denote the number of ways to climb n stairs as S(n). We can establish the following recurrence relation:

S(n) = S(n-1) + S(n-2)

This means that the number of ways to climb n stairs is equal to the sum of the number of ways to climb (n-1) stairs (by taking one step) and the number of ways to climb (n-2) stairs (by taking two steps).

To calculate S(n), we can start with the base cases:

S(0) = 1 (There is one way to climb 0 stairs, by not taking any steps.)

S(1) = 1 (There is one way to climb 1 stair, by taking one step.)

Then, we can use the recurrence relation to compute S(n) iteratively for larger values of n.

For example, let's calculate S(3):

S(0) = 1 (base case)

S(1) = 1 (base case)

S(2) = S(1) + S(0) = 1 + 1 = 2

S(3) = S(2) + S(1) = 2 + 1 = 3

In hypothesis testing, when performing a Z-test for a mean and the population standard deviation (σ) is known, two assumptions need to be satisfied:

a) The sample is a random sample: This ensures that the sample is representative of the population and helps in generalizing the results to the population.

b) Either n ≥ 25 or the population is normally distributed if n < 25: This assumption is based on the Central Limit Theorem. When the sample size (n) is large enough (typically considered as n ≥ 25), the distribution of the sample mean approaches a normal distribution regardless of the population distribution. However, when the sample size is small (n < 25), it is important to ensure that the population follows a normal distribution for accurate inference.

Therefore, both assumptions a) and b) need to be satisfied for the Z-test for a mean when the population standard deviation is known.

To evaluate the given code and determine the resulting value of the variable "c," we need to understand the operation being performed.

The symbol "^" represents the bitwise XOR (exclusive OR) operator in programming. When applied to two operands, it compares the corresponding bits and returns 1 if they are different, and 0 if they are the same.

In this case, we have two variables, "a" and "b," each storing a character value. The ASCII value for the character 'A' is 65, and for 'V' is 86.

Now, let's convert the decimal ASCII values of 'A' and 'V' into their binary representations:

65 (decimal) = 01000001 (binary)
86 (decimal) = 01010110 (binary)

Applying the bitwise XOR operation to each pair of bits, we get:

01000001
XOR 01010110
-----------
00010111

Therefore, the resulting binary value for variable "c" is 00010111.

(i) To find the maximum and minimum possible values of u · v, we can use the properties of vector dot product. The dot product of two vectors u and v is given by the equation:

u · v = ∥u∥ ∥v∥ cos θ

where θ is the angle between the two vectors.

Since ∥u∥ = 3 and ∥v∥ = 9, we have:

u · v = 3 * 9 * cos θ = 27 cos θ

The maximum value of cos θ is 1 when the vectors are aligned, so the maximum possible value of u · v is 27 * 1 = 27.

The minimum value of cos θ is -1 when the vectors are oppositely aligned, so the minimum possible value of u · v is 27 * (-1) = -27.

(ii) To find the maximum and minimum possible values of ∥u - v∥, we can use the triangle inequality for vectors. The triangle inequality states that for any two vectors u and v, the magnitude of their difference ∥u - v∥ is less than or equal to the sum of their magnitudes:

∥u - v∥ ≤ ∥u∥ + ∥v∥

Substituting the given magnitudes, we have:

∥u - v∥ ≤ 3 + 9 = 12

Therefore, the maximum possible value of ∥u - v∥ is 12.
